Overall review
StoryThe film 'Hi' follows Mayilsamy, a romantic who runs away to Chennai after being rejected by his love interest. In this bustling city, he encounters Devayani, who is also fleeing from an arranged marriage. As they find refuge at a mutual friend's house, Mayilsamy's feelings for Devayani grow, but their situation becomes complicated when people from their village come searching for them. To protect Devayani, Mayilsamy tells a lie, setting off a series of comedic and romantic events that keep the audience entertained.
What WorksThe film shines with strong performances, particularly from Kavin, who delivers a lively and enjoyable performance, adding charm to the film. Nayanthara's presence enhances the film's appeal, providing star power and emotional depth. The supporting cast, including Bhagyaraj, Prabhu, and Radhika Sarathkumar, contribute significantly with their performances, even if their roles are not as substantial as they could be. 'Hi' maintains a pleasant tone with effective humor. Kavin's comedic timing and expressions, along with Director Vishnu Edavan's unique humor style, add to the film's comedic appeal, making it a delightful watch. The film successfully captures a charming and nostalgic tone, reminiscent of old-school family entertainers. It offers a nostalgic tribute to classic Tamil cinema, balancing romance and comedy effectively to create a feel-good experience. Engaging music and visuals also stand out, with Jen Martin's songs and background score being tastefully conceived and engaging. The cinematography by Rajesh Sukla contributes to the film's vibrant and visually appealing presentation.
What Doesn't WorkDespite its strengths, 'Hi' suffers from a predictable and outdated storyline. The film offers nothing new and resembles several movies seen before, lacking originality and failing to fully engage the audience. The writing and execution are weak in parts, with the narrative feeling stretched and some scenes poorly staged. This impacts the film's overall quality, making certain parts feel convenient and less impactful. The supporting cast, though talented, is underutilized. Veteran actors like Radhika Sarathkumar and Prabhu have no substantial roles, which is a missed opportunity given their potential. A lack of chemistry between the leads diminishes the emotional impact of the film. While Kavin and Nayanthara deliver strong solo performances, their chemistry in combination scenes feels off. Pacing issues arise in the second half, with the film losing steam and some scenes dragging on. Certain emotional stretches feel prolonged and could have been shorter to maintain a better pace.
Direction & CraftThe editing by Philomin Raj needed sharper execution, as several scenes could have been cut to maintain a better pace. Jen Martin's music is a significant part of the film's presentation, with tastefully conceived songs that enhance the viewing experience. Cinematographer Rajesh Sukla has contributed to the visual appeal of the film, making it vibrant and engaging.
Verdict'Hi' is a romantic comedy that offers charming performances and engaging humor, but it struggles with a predictable storyline and pacing issues. While it provides entertainment value and features a strong cast, it lacks originality and emotional depth. Best suited for viewers who enjoy light-hearted romantic comedies with a nostalgic touch.

Cinema Express describes 'Hi' as a charming romcom that effectively balances romance and comedy, showcasing the journey of two characters, Mayilsamy and Devayani, who find love amidst their personal struggles. The film is praised for its performances, particularly by Nayanthara and Kavin, and its nostalgic nods to classic Hollywood romcoms, though it does face some narrative clutter in the latter half. Overall, it offers a feel-good experience that resonates with themes of desire and love.
